As nouns the difference between refresh and refreshment

is that refresh is the periodic energizing required to maintain the contents of computer memory, the display luminance of a computer screen, etc while refreshment is the action of refreshing; a means of restoring strength, energy or vigour.

As a verb refresh

is to renew or revitalize.
